According to South Portland police, the Portland Water District will be repairing a water main at the intersection of Waterman Drive and Broadway in South Portland on Sunday, April 12, from 7 a.m. to 7 p.m. Westbound traffic will be shut down, and other directions will be experiencing significant delays. NFL notebook: Steelers’ standout safety retires
PITTSBURGH — Troy Polamalu’s career now belongs to the ages. The Pittsburgh Steelers announced the star safety’s retirement on Friday following a spectacular 12 seasons in the NFL that included eight Pro Bowls, four first-team All-Pro selections and two Super Bowl rings.
